Overview
Together CK Core Grants provide matching funds for community organizations in Chatham-Kent, with up to 50% of operating expenses funded to a maximum of $25,000. The program supports operational and program-specific initiatives that address community needs and strengthen organizational capacity.

Activities funded
- Operational initiatives that support Council Term Priorities.
- Program-specific initiatives that meet community needs.
Eligibility
Who is eligible?
- Non-profit corporations.
- Registered Canadian charities.
Who is not eligible
- International organizations.
- National organizations.
- Provincial organizations.
Eligible expenses
- Operating expenses.
Eligible geographic areas
- Chatham-Kent.
Processing and Agreement
- Applications are reviewed through a competitive process.
- Funding recommendations are reviewed by Council for approval.
- Applicants are notified of funding decisions by email.
Additional information
- Applications are assessed by a Review Committee.
- Funding notifications to applicants are sent in early September.
- The program is part of the Together CK municipal funding portfolio.
